O. C. Bear Guitars
I am having an acoustic guitar made by Clint Bear of O.C. Bear Guitars. I played a Nick Lucas that had a sound that just popped. Loved it. My guitar is a Madison which is an OM, cocobolo back and sides and Red Spruce top. I am very excited about receiving this instrument. I write to ask if anyone can tell me a story or relate an experience concerning Clint's craftmanship?

You're a lucky boy! I sold my O.C. Bear Jefferson over the Summer....been pining for it ever since. Really really wish I had it back!!!! I've had the Jefferson and a Madison. I think Clint Bears workmanship is outstanding. And the sound is just fabulous. If I ever do come across one and money allows I would definitely jump on it. There is a nice one, owned by a forum member, on Reverb now that looks like a real beauty.... Hope you enjoy it and look forward to your NGD post.
